How much do associate producer television j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ate producer television in the United States is $69,622.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$56,000.00 and $77,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an associate producer do in television?

An Associate Producer (AP) in television assists the producer and production team with various tasks throughout the production process. Their responsibilities often include helping to develop scripts, coordinating schedules, managing logistics, and communicating between different departments. APs may also contribute to research, oversee certain production segments, and help ensure projects stay on track and within budget. The role is vital for supporting the smooth operation of television shows, whether in news, entertainment, or other formats.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an associate producer in television?

To thrive as an Associate Producer in Television, you generally need a background in media production, strong organizational skills, and experience coordinating multiple aspects of TV projects, often supported by a degree in communications or related fields. Familiarity with production software such as Avid, Adobe Premiere, and scheduling tools, as well as knowledge of broadcast standards, is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and the ability to work under tight deadlines help set standout Associate Producers apart. These skills are essential for ensuring smooth production workflows, meeting broadcast requirements, and delivering high-quality content on time.

What are typical challenges an associate producer faces when coordinating between different departments on a television production?

Associate Producers often act as the bridge between creative teams, technical crews, and management, which can make communication and coordination a challenge. Balancing the creative vision of producers and directors with the practical constraints of budget, schedule, and resources requires strong organizational and interpersonal skills. It's common to encounter last-minute script changes, logistical issues, or technical setbacks, so adaptability and problem-solving abilities are essential in this role. Building strong relationships across departments and maintaining clear, timely communication help ensure the production stays on track.

Job description

Local News Associate Producer (Entry Level)

40/29, the ABC affiliate in Rogers, AR.  has an opening for an Part-time Associate Producer. You will assist producers in all aspects of producing a newscast. This will include writing stories, creating graphics, researching information, and using video. Associate Producers also help make phone calls to gather information about stories. In addition to writing for our broadcasts, our associate producers are also assigned to write/post stories daily to our website and social media sites and have writing and tape editing skills. You will report to the News Director. This is a wonderful opportunity if you are looking to get your foot in the door and get started in a career in journalism.

Responsibilities

  • Write copy for daily newscasts and edit videos
  • Assist producers and reporters with research
  • Collaborate with assignment editors, producers, reporters, photographers, editors, production staff and news managers
  • Understand social media and be able to produce content on our digital platforms
  • Research and write stories for television and digital platforms
  • Make follow up calls and beat calls

Requirements

  • Familiarity with social media
  • Writing and verbal skills
  • Work on deadlines
  • Related military experience will be considered
